LUFA GenericHID callbacks question
My problems went away when I made all endpoints and report sizes equal. I dont think thats a requirment, but on the host app side, the 'segmented' reports was causing...
Tuesday, 20 May 2014 - 10:57
I'm still troubleshooting this problem. Normal operation is the HID device stuffs volatile sensor data into the send packet and waits to get polled. Thats works fine. Then...
Tuesday, 20 May 2014 - 02:56
Doh! So that is whats happening! I went from a half empty 32u2 to a nearly full 16u2, changed the FLASH_SIZE_BYTES, but the software jump to bootloader no longer worked. Glad I...
Wednesday, 14 May 2014 - 21:06
LUFA ring buffer init problem
Yep, agreed, 128 was the result of lazy cut-paste, and I ended up in the stack.
Tuesday, 6 May 2014 - 18:04
I'm guessing I need to go find ye' old stack monitor code and see what going on.
Tuesday, 6 May 2014 - 06:52
LUFA and Raspberry Pi
Oh yeh, I have a openwrt'd wifi router with usb. Thanks for the guidance to focus on libusb.
Friday, 16 August 2013 - 14:31
Thanks for the reply. I assumed it was possible, I just haven't messed with linux since the pre-usb days. And then was suprised to not find any LUFA generic HID projects with the...
Friday, 16 August 2013 - 00:47
ATmega32U4 Real Time Loop & USB
Looked at usb_rawhid.c and it looks like it turns global interrupts off and on while it tries to send data/or timeout. I remembered what you need to check on the host side. Make...
Tuesday, 19 February 2013 - 17:58
Also, looks like you only use a few bytes in the USB data. If you dont need the 64 byte size, either make it smaller, or fill it up then send it. Also, HID is not really designed...
Tuesday, 19 February 2013 - 17:21
You have a 50msec timeout on the send.. usb_hid_send(buffer, 50); If I remember correctly, the PJRC code will sit in a blocking while loop with interrupts disabled until it...
Tuesday, 19 February 2013 - 17:09
LUFA Endpoint_ConfigureEndpoint double check
thanks for the confirmation. love the LUFA.
Friday, 8 February 2013 - 19:49
Oh yeh, can anyone verify this: Quote:Going from 111009 to 120730, on a GenericHID style project. In the 120730 Endpoint_ConfigureEndpoint, for bank size param, does 1= single...
Thursday, 7 February 2013 - 23:29